* Activision/Id Software's 'Doom 3' explodes into the Top 40 at No1 pushing their own Activision published 'Spider-Man 2' down to No2 and becoming the 5th fastest selling PC game in the UK based on launch week. 'Doom 3' (PC) achieves higher launch week sales than 'Spider-Man 2' on PS2, becoming the first PC exclusive title to reach No1 in an All Formats Chart since Eidos' 'Championship Manager 4' (week 13, 2003). 'Doom 3' accounts for over 17% of all PC game sales this week. With the Olympics in full swing Sony's 'Athens 2004' (PS2) jumps from No5 to No3, while Activision's 'Shrek 2' (down from No3 to No7) is squeezed down the chart by new entries 'Doom 3' and Vivendi's critically acclaimed movie tie-in 'The Chronicles of Riddick: Escape from Butcher Bay' (XB) which enters at No5. There are now 7 movie tie-in games in the Top 40 with EA's 'Catwoman' which was released last week clawing its way into the Top 40 for the first time (debuting at No17). This week's Top 40 highest climber is Play It's 'America's 10 Most Wanted' (PS2), up 11 places from No22 to No11.
